
Is Nolan Ryan #90 worth grading?
Baseball · Baseball Cards 1993 Score Select · full price guide →
Strong grading candidate — 72× premium in PSA 10
A PSA 10 Nolan Ryan #90 sells for $99.75 against $1.38 raw: a $98.37 spread, 72× the ungraded price. A PSA 9 ($20.25) only about breaks even after fees, so the case rests on gemming. Centering is the usual reason a clean copy misses the 10 — measure it before you submit.

Break-even by outcome and fee
| If it comes back… | Sells for | Economy / bulk (~$25.00) | Standard (~$50.00) | Express (~$150) |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Gem — PSA 10 | $99.75 | +$73.37 | +$48.37 | −$51.63 |
| PSA 9 | $20.25 | −$6.13 | −$31.13 | −$131 |
| PSA 8 | $18.00 | −$8.38 | −$33.38 | −$133 |
Net = sale price − $1.38 raw value − fee. Fee tiers are illustrative; plug your grader's current price into the calculator below.
Expected value — how often does it need to gem?
| Chance it gems | Expected sale | Expected net (standard fee) |
|---|---|---|
| 25% | $40.13 | −$11.26 |
| 50% | $60.00 | +$8.62 |
| 75% | $79.88 | +$28.50 |
Break-even gem rate at the standard fee: about 39%. Centering is the usual reason a clean copy misses — measure it before you decide.
Which grader pays the most — and what a 10 takes
All centering standards →| Grader | 10 sells for | vs best | Front centering for a 10 | Back |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| BGS 10 | $130 | best | 55/45 | 70/30 |
| PSA 10 | $99.75 | −$30.25 | 55/45 | 75/25 |
| CGC 10 | $60.00 | −$70.00 | 55/45 | 75/25 |
| SGC 10 | $60.00 | −$70.00 | 55/45 | 75/25 |
Tolerances are each company's published centering standard for its top grade; surface, corners and edges must also be clean. Centering is the one you can measure yourself before you pay.
